What does the role involve?As a Graduate Transport Planner, you’ll work closely with experienced and consultants to:
- Collect, analyse, and appraise data related to transport systems, including traffic patterns, public transport usage, and demographic data
- Provide day to day technical input as part of a team of consultants
- Producing clear, well-reasoned, and persuasive reports that effectively interpret data and other evidence, ensuring findings are communicated effectively to stakeholders
- Ensure your output is completed in accordance with the scope of works, timescales and budgets
- Work in close collaboration with colleagues from other disciplines as required to deliver project requirements and added value to the client
- Engaging with the Transport Planning Society's Professional Development Scheme, which supports your progression towards becoming a Chartered Transport Planning Professional, enhancing your skills and career development in the field

What do you need to apply?We want to hear from you if you…
- Have a degree relevant to the role you’re applying for.
- Have less than 12 months of relevant work experience (excluding placements).
- Are confident using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, Outlook, Teams, PowerPoint).
- Are driven, proactive, and solution-oriented.
- Can work in the UK without restrictions either now or in the future. This is a permanent role, and we’re looking for candidates who can grow their careers with Sweco without a time limit.
